Seasonal flowers are cheaper:Seasonal varieties are often less expensive when in great abundance. For example, roses are a super value in summer because it is their peak growing season. Cut the stems: If you receive flowers in a box or tissue, remove all of the foliage that falls below the water line, then cut the stems with a sharp knife in a sink full of warm water. Be sure to cut the stems under the water and place them immediately into a vase of warm water mixed with the floral food provided by your florist.
